McCormick Stevenson Congratulates Nat McCormick on Earning Mechanical Engineering Degree

McCormick Stevenson’s Director of Armament & Electronic Systems, Nat McCormick, recently earned a degree in Mechanical Engineering from the University of South Florida (USF) College of Engineering. After working for McCormick Stevenson for a number of years as a drafter and designer, Nat felt a strong desire to expand his understanding of “how things work” which led him to pursue his engineering degree. When asked to describe his experience working full-time, attending school and upholding his family commitments, Nat said, “I am blessed to have had the opportunity to work full-time while in school. It gave me context to the engineering concepts and courses and helped to keep me focused. The staff and faculty at St. Petersburg College and the University of South Florida were world-class and really worked with me to achieve my goal. It was also a significant morale booster to know that I had the full support of my family at home and my colleagues at McCormick Stevenson. I would not have been able to do it without my support group cheering me on. Now that I’m done it’s time to get to work! Go Bulls!”

We are so proud of your accomplishment, Nat!
